Have you used the St Thomas Ritz Kids Club? (or any other)
 
I have never left my kids in any of the daycare services at resorts. We are going to the Ritz in STT, and then the STJ Westin in November. Does anyone have any experience with these types of services? My boys will be 7,7, and 9 when we travel.

My husband and I have a 7 year old and we have traveled quite a bit and she loves to go the kids club. We use to live overseas so we traveled a great deal and she has always enjoyed making friends at the kids club. When we vacation we stay quite a bit at the Ritz's because they really do have a great kid's club. Sometimes she is the only child in there and the people who work there really make it alot of fun.
